HOOOS

分布式存储的设计理念与案例分析

0 220 数据工程师 分布式存储数据管理技术案例
Apple

在当今数据驱动的时代,分布式存储已经成为了处理海量数据的首选解决方案。与传统的集中式存储相比,分布式存储不仅能够提升数据的访问速度,还能有效地增加数据的可靠性与可扩展性。本文将探讨分布式存储的设计理念,并结合实际案例进行深入分析。

分布式存储的设计理念

分布式存储系统由多个存储节点组成,每个节点都可以独立地存储和管理数据。这种设计理念有几个关键点:

  1. 数据冗余与持久性:通过将数据冗余存储于多个节点,即使某个节点宕机,数据依然可以通过其他节点恢复,提升了数据的安全性。

  2. 负载均衡:在访问数据时,系统可以根据每个节点的负载情况动态地将请求分配给不同的节点,避免了性能瓶颈,增强了系统的整体响应能力。

  3. 容错与自我修复:分布式存储系统通常具备自动检测节点故障的能力,能够迅速将数据迁移至健康节点,并恢复正常服务。

真实案例分析

案例一:某社交网络平台的分布式存储实践

在一家大型社交网络平台中,由于用户上传的图片与视频数量激增,传统的存储方式已无法满足需求。他们采用了Apache Cassandra作为分布式存储解决方案。通过设计多副本策略,将数据分布在全球多个数据中心,确保了数据的高可用性与快速访问。

案例二:云存储服务的优化

某云存储服务提供商通过实施分布式文件系统(如HDFS),将用户数据切分为较小的块,并分散存储在不同的服务器上。这样不仅使数据处理更快速,也提升了对用户并发请求的处理能力。随着业务的发展,系统的可扩展性使其能够在短时间内无缝增加存储节点,满足不断增长的需求。

结论

分布式存储的设计理念注重数据的安全性、访问速度及系统的灵活性。通过实际案例我们可以看到,分布式存储不仅能够解决当前数据增长带来的挑战,还能为未来的发展提供坚实的基础。企业在选择存储方案时,应根据自身的需求和业务特点,结合分布式存储的优势,做出合适的决策。

点评评价

captcha
健康